Transaction 34690846dfb153c0b529b9a352abc2c80e854c0a2adbce2e056a8c3ef814d5ea
1 Input
1 Output
-
34690846dfb153c0b529b9a352abc2c80e854c0a2adbce2e056a8c3ef814d5ea:0
- value
- 8328755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 872ab6a5c1899b71bfcb7cef758e169262acdd4e OP_EQUAL
- address
- 3E1iKDyfcyvzJbif9bJDdD37qcphYLkKR4